Royal Challengers Bengaluru (RCB) face a tense chase in Match 70 of IPL 2025 after Rishabh Pant’s breathtaking 118* (61 balls, 11 fours, 8 sixes) rocketed Lucknow Super Giants (LSG) to 227/3 at the Ekana Cricket Stadium, Lucknow. RCB’s stand-in skipper Jitesh Sharma won the toss and bowled, aiming to seal a top-two finish and the coveted extra chance in the playoffs. The visitors drew first blood when Nuwan Thushara uprooted debutant Matthew Breetzke’s off-stump, yet Pant’s early entry flipped momentum. The LSG captain sprinted to 50 off 29 deliveries and, in tandem with the in-form Mitchell Marsh (67 off 37), stitched a 152-run stand that bulldozed an RCB attack missing Josh Hazlewood and Tim David. Key powerplay moments • Pant slog-swept Yash Dayal for a towering leg-side six, signalling intent. • Marsh punished loose Yorkers and slower balls, taking Thushara for 20 in the 16th over. • Pant celebrated his third IPL ton with a crowd-pleasing front-flip, pushing LSG beyond 200 with two overs to spare. Chasing 228, RCB sent Phil Salt and Virat Kohli to the top. Salt’s 30 (19) and Kohli’s rapid 37* (19) propelled them to 76/1 after seven overs, but the required rate remains above 11.5. Rajat Patidar has joined Kohli after Salt miscued Akash Singh, leaving the Bengaluru camp banking on their talisman and aggressive middle order to script the league’s highest successful run-chase this season. What’s at stake • A win guarantees RCB 18 points and second place, setting up a Qualifier 1 clash with Punjab Kings. • Defeat would drop them to third, forcing an Eliminator showdown against Mumbai Indians on 30 May. • LSG, already out of playoff contention, are playing spoilers and showcasing Pant’s resurgence after an injury-curtailed 2024. Pitch & conditions The mixed-soil strip—Odisha black blended with Mumbai red—played true for stroke-making once the new-ball swing faded. Dew is expected to aid RCB’s pursuit, but the 74-metre straight boundary and two-paced bounce demand smart strike rotation alongside power hitting. Trending players to watch • Virat Kohli: needs 64 more to reclaim the Orange Cap from Shubman Gill. • Rishabh Pant: climbed into the top-five run-getters, igniting talk of an India T20 World Cup recall. • Nuwan Thushara: slingy action and early wickets bolster RCB’s pace stocks ahead of the knockouts.
